"Notifies users when their roaming profile is slow to load. The notice lets users decide whether to use a local copy or to wait for the roaming user profile. If you disable this setting or do not configure it, when a roaming user profile is slow to load, the system does not consult the user. Instead, it loads the local copy of the profile. If you have enabled the "Wait for remote user profile" setting, the system loads the remote copy without consulting the user. This setting and related settings in this folder together define the system's response when roaming user profiles are slow to load. To adjust the time within which the user must respond to this notice, use the "Timeout for dialog boxes" setting. Important: If the "Do not detect slow network connections" setting is enabled, this setting is ignored. Also, if the "Delete cached copies of roaming profiles" setting is enabled, there is no local copy of the roaming profile to load when the system detects a slow connection."
